The Larkspur cut-over finished overnight without rollback. From this release forward, all transitive dependencies are pinned via the lockfile generated by Pinwheel; floating version ranges will fail the build. Teams were notified last sprint, and the three holdout repos were patched by Mira's group yesterday. Release notes should mention that hotfixes now require a lockfile refresh before tagging. The enforcement gate reads its thresholds from the deploy manifest. For reference, these are the current production configuration values:

service settings:
[casax]
port = 6379
team = rusir
host = casax.zemvarhq.corp
region = outer-4
access_code = ac_9808ce
timeout_ms = 1500

## Read-Replica Lag Alarm

New folks: the ReplicaLagHigh alarm covers the Ostrel reporting replicas. It fires when lag exceeds 90 seconds for five minutes. Most triggers come from the nightly Bramwell export job, which is expected and auto-resolves. Do not fail over the replica yourself — that requires the data-platform lead's approval and a change ticket. If the alarm persists past 20 minutes with no export running, write to the platform inbox.

billing contact of yahip-yadup = eliax.druix@zemvarworks.corp

## Rotating secrets with VaultSpin

Plugin authors integrating with VaultSpin must never cache rotated material locally. When your plugin detects a rotation event, re-fetch credentials from the Kestrelworks broker within 30 seconds, then confirm receipt via the ack endpoint. Test rotations run every Tuesday in the Plover staging cluster. For staging verification, authenticate against the broker using the key below.

service key, kaduf-bawig: kto15_Ze79S0dligTw0yO